A group of White Garden Snails (Theba pisana) has chosen cleverly a safe place to aestivate. On top of a dry Milk Thistle Plant (Silybum marianum) four White Garden Snails enjoy the protection of the now dry and spiny leaves of the Thistle plant, staying well over the ground adds additional security during aestivation.
